Keys to Achievement 5: Stick With Your Recipe


Life is not easy for any of us. But what of that? We must have perseverance and above all confidence in ourselves. We must believe that we are gifted for something and that this thing must be attained. - Marie Curie

It's been said that "there are many ways to skin a cat". Not so great news for the cat, but for us, it's a great reminder to stick with the habits that generate results, even if they are slightly different than others.

Today's day and age is all about improvement, optimization, enhancements, and efficiency. Every sales pitch tries to convince you that their product or service will get you to your goal better, faster, and more effectively than the other guy's.

While innovation is the mother of invention, too much focus on change and upgrades will be deadly to our personal daily productivity. We can spend so much time looking for the next best thing that we never get around to achieving anything. Sometimes the best thing we can do is to stick with the present formula that works and stop trying to improve it.

There is no plan B. It distracts from Plan A. - Will Smith

Take Kentucky Fried Chicken or McDonald's for example. Both franchises have grown into iconic, if not legendary status by sticking to the simple formula that people have grown to love. By doing so, they created a predictable product to which customers have become very loyal.

We all have gifts and abilities that are unique to us - designed by God and developed over time and practice. And they work. Those habits shape our unique personalities and perspectives and they make us highly effective. Like the Colonel and Ray Croc, once you identify your unique formula for success, stick with it and give your customers a chance to become loyal followers.

Are there areas of your personal or business life that you have been continually trying to improve? Has that search for the "next best thing" distracted you from truly engaging where you are, with what you have, to generate results? Are you missing out on opportunities because you're too busy searching for innovation.

Perhaps your recipe is good as it is. Perhaps all that's needed is for you to stop searching and start doing. In short, stick with your 'secret sauce'
